Azerbaijani official critical of local insurance companies

In no country of the world does the state compensate for damage caused by a natural disaster, because the insurance system handles this, Ziyad Samadzade, Chairman of the Committee on Economic Policy, Industry and Entrepreneurship, said at a meeting of the committee on April 5, Trend reports.

The chairman noted that insurance companies, as a rule, are being excluded from risky areas.

"Insurance companies collect premiums, but do not compensate for damage when an accident occurs. This is a very serious matter. People hope that the state will take the responsibility [for compensating damages caused by natural disasters or tragedies] and compensate for the damage. But such practice does not exist in any country of the world. Imagine how many tragedies and natural disasters have occurred in the last 10-15 years, when the state took the responsibility for compensating damages."

According to Samadzade, it is important to develop the insurance market in Azerbaijan.

"It will be appropriate to hold hearings with the participation of government agencies, insurance companies, deputies and specialists, where issues on eliminating problems in the insurance industry will be discussed."
